I'm not sure what you mean by "iTunes-like tree menu".  The method
used for lazily creating hierarchical menus is -[NSObject
menu:updateItem:atIndex:shouldCancel:].

Sorry, I don't actually mean a menu, but I'd like to bind an outline view to a Core Data model, and have it take on the graphical style and appearance of the outline view in iTunes.


How would I go about doing this?
